✨ Hans-Jürgen Döpp, 1940–2025
Few people have shared their wisdom, experience – and wonderful collection of erotic art – more than Hans-Jürgen Döpp, who sadly died last year at the age of 84. For more than half a century Hans-Jürgen devoted himself to the study and collection of erotic art, not as a marginal curiosity or a private indulgence, but as an essential part of human culture. Through his work as a scholar, teacher, curator, author and collector, he helped establish erotic art as a serious field of artistic and historical enquiry. He was an enthusiastic supporter of honesterotica, sharing more than 200 of his portfolios with us, helping to make the website a unique resource of erotic art that would otherwise have been lost to the world.
